Conditions

Hypertensive disease. Hypertensive heart disease

Interventions

Intervention 1: Intervention group: The intervention of group one, in addition to the usual treatment, will be an educational-supportive intervention (usual care plus intervention) through a software

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Willingness to participate in the study Definitive diagnosis of hypertension (equal to or greater than 90.140 mm Hg, 3 times a day) and at least one month after the onset of hypertension Systolic and diastolic blood pressure equal to or greater than 90.140 mm Hg Having a mobile phone with the ability to install software Ability to work with software in the patient or a family member to use the software (such as vision and the ability to work with hands, having the ability to work with mobile phones at least at the beginner level Familiarity with Persian language (reading, writing and speaking) yourself or a family member Do not suffer from neurological diseases and learning disorders No other chronic diseases such as stroke, crippling diseases (multiple sclerosis, Guillain-Barré syndrome), dialysis, cardiomyopathy, malignant tumors and pregnancy

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Reluctance to continue cooperation in research Occurrence of other diseases requiring therapeutic intervention during the study

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Adherence to the treatment plan of patients with hypertension. Timepoint: Before intervention - two months after intervention. Method of measurement: Researcher-made questionnaire on adherence to treatment regimen.;Blood pressure. Timepoint: Before the intervention and at each visit - the pressures recorded in the software. Method of measurement: Mercury sphygmomanometer.;Lifestyle training. Timepoint: Before intervention - two months after intervention. Method of measurement: Questionnaire developed by the researcher on treatment compliance.;Regular monitoring of blood pressure. Timepoint: Every other day. Method of measurement: Registration in the software.
